PAN-GRILLED SALMON WITH PINEAPPLE SALSA
Fish
is an excellent source of lean protein which makes this dish a famous choice
for either dinner or even lunch. Salmon contains heart healthy fats known as
omega 3s and loaded with monounsaturated fats which are particularly good for
weight loss plans.
Ingredients
- 1 cup chopped fresh pineapple
- 2 tablespoons finely chopped red onion
- 2 tablespoons chopped cilantro
- 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
- 1/8 teaspoon ground red pepper
- Cooking spray
- 4 (6-ounce) salmon fillets (about 1/2-inch thick)
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
Preparation
1. Combine
first 5 ingredients (through pepper) in a bowl; set aside.
2. Heat
a nonstick grill pan coated with cooking spray over medium-high heat. Sprinkle
fish with salt. Cook fish 4 minutes on each side or until it flakes easily when
tested with a fork. Top with salsa.
ΓΌ Yield: Serves 4 (serving size: 1 fillet and 1/3 cup
salsa)
Nutritional
Information
Calories
per serving:
|
294
|
Calories
from fat:
|
41%
|
Fat
per serving:
|
13.2g
|
Saturated
fat per serving:
|
3.1g
|
Monounsaturated
fat per serving:
|
5.7g
|
Polyunsaturated
fat per serving:
|
3.2g
|
Protein
per serving:
|
36.4g
|
Carbohydrates
per serving:
|
5.6g
|
Fiber
per serving:
|
0.6g
|
Cholesterol
per serving:
|
87mg
|
Iron
per serving:
|
0.8mg
|
Sodium
per serving:
|
375mg
|
Calcium
per serving:
|
26mg
|
